Affected Products:

  * Confidential Computing Module 15-SP6
  * SUSE Linux Enterprise Server 15 SP6
  * SUSE Linux Enterprise Server for SAP Applications 15 SP6

  
  
An update that solves 149 vulnerabilities, contains two features and has 36
security fixes can now be installed.

## Description:

The SUSE Linux Enterprise 15 SP6 Confidential Computing kernel was updated to
receive various security bugfixes.

The following security bugs were fixed:

  * CVE-2025-39782: jbd2: prevent softlockup in jbd2_log_do_checkpoint()
    (bsc#1249526).
  * CVE-2025-39773: net: bridge: fix soft lockup in br_multicast_query_expired()
    (bsc#1249504).
  * CVE-2025-39746: wifi: ath10k: shutdown driver when hardware is unreliable
    (bsc#1249516).
  * CVE-2025-39718: vsock/virtio: Validate length in packet header before
    skb_put() (bsc#1249305).
  * CVE-2025-39705: drm/amd/display: fix a Null pointer dereference
    vulnerability (bsc#1249295).
  * CVE-2025-39703: net, hsr: reject HSR frame if skb can't hold tag
    (bsc#1249315).
  * CVE-2025-39691: fs/buffer: fix use-after-free when call bh_read() helper
    (bsc#1249374).
  * CVE-2025-39682: tls: fix handling of zero-length records on the rx_list
    (bsc#1249284).
  * CVE-2025-39678: platform/x86/amd/hsmp: Ensure sock->metric_tbl_addr is non-
    NULL (bsc#1249290).
  * CVE-2025-38732: netfilter: nf_reject: do not leak dst refcount for loopback
    packets (bsc#1249262).
  * CVE-2025-38730: io_uring/net: commit partial buffers on retry (bsc#1249172).
  * CVE-2025-38722: habanalabs: fix UAF in export_dmabuf() (bsc#1249163).
  * CVE-2025-38721: netfilter: ctnetlink: fix refcount leak on table dump
    (bsc#1249176).
  * CVE-2025-38709: loop: Avoid updating block size under exclusive owner
    (bsc#1249199).
  * CVE-2025-38705: drm/amd/pm: fix null pointer access (bsc#1249334).
  * CVE-2025-38701: ext4: do not BUG when INLINE_DATA_FL lacks system.data xattr
    (bsc#1249258).
  * CVE-2025-38679: media: venus: Fix OOB read due to missing payload bound
    check (bsc#1249202).
  * CVE-2025-38678: netfilter: nf_tables: reject duplicate device on updates
    (bsc#1249126).
  * CVE-2025-38676: iommu/amd: Avoid stack buffer overflow from kernel cmdline
    (bsc#1248775).
  * CVE-2025-38668: regulator: core: fix NULL dereference on unbind due to stale
    coupling data (bsc#1248647).
  * CVE-2025-38664: ice: Fix a null pointer dereference in
    ice_copy_and_init_pkg() (bsc#1248628).
  * CVE-2025-38660: [ceph] parse_longname(): strrchr() expects NUL-terminated
    string (bsc#1248634).
  * CVE-2025-38659: gfs2: No more self recovery (bsc#1248639).
  * CVE-2025-38645: net/mlx5: Check device memory pointer before usage
    (bsc#1248626).
  * CVE-2025-38643: wifi: cfg80211: Add missing lock in
    cfg80211_check_and_end_cac() (bsc#1248681).
  * CVE-2025-38640: bpf: Disable migration in nf_hook_run_bpf() (bsc#1248622).
  * CVE-2025-38639: netfilter: xt_nfacct: do not assume acct name is null-
    terminated (bsc#1248674).
  * CVE-2025-38623: PCI: pnv_php: Fix surprise plug detection and recovery
    (bsc#1248610).
  * CVE-2025-38622: net: drop UFO packets in udp_rcv_segment() (bsc#1248619).
  * CVE-2025-38618: vsock: Do not allow binding to VMADDR_PORT_ANY
    (bsc#1248511).
  * CVE-2025-38614: eventpoll: Fix semi-unbounded recursion (bsc#1248392).
  * CVE-2025-38608: bpf, ktls: Fix data corruption when using bpf_msg_pop_data()
    in ktls (bsc#1248338).
  * CVE-2025-38605: wifi: ath12k: Pass ab pointer directly to
    ath12k_dp_tx_get_encap_type() (bsc#1248334).
  * CVE-2025-38597: drm/rockchip: vop2: fail cleanly if missing a primary plane
    for a video-port (bsc#1248378).
  * CVE-2025-38595: xen: fix UAF in dmabuf_exp_from_pages() (bsc#1248380).
  * CVE-2025-38593: kABI workaround for bluetooth discovery_state change
    (bsc#1248357).
  * CVE-2025-38591: bpf: Reject narrower access to pointer ctx fields
    (bsc#1248363).
  * CVE-2025-38590: net/mlx5e: Remove skb secpath if xfrm state is not found
    (bsc#1248360).
  * CVE-2025-38585: staging: media: atomisp: Fix stack buffer overflow in
    gmin_get_var_int() (bsc#1248355).
  * CVE-2025-38574: pptp: ensure minimal skb length in pptp_xmit()
    (bsc#1248365).
  * CVE-2025-38560: x86/sev: Evict cache lines during SNP memory validation
    (bsc#1248312).
  * CVE-2025-38556: HID: core: Harden s32ton() against conversion to 0 bits
    (bsc#1248296).
  * CVE-2025-38546: atm: clip: Fix memory leak of struct clip_vcc (bsc#1248223).
  * CVE-2025-38544: rxrpc: Fix bug due to prealloc collision (bsc#1248225).
  * CVE-2025-38533: net: libwx: fix the using of Rx buffer DMA (bsc#1248200).
  * CVE-2025-38531: iio: common: st_sensors: Fix use of uninitialize device
    structs (bsc#1248205).
  * CVE-2025-38528: bpf: Reject %p% format string in bprintf-like helpers
    (bsc#1248198).
  * CVE-2025-38527: smb: client: fix use-after-free in cifs_oplock_break
    (bsc#1248199).
  * CVE-2025-38526: ice: add NULL check in eswitch lag check (bsc#1248192).
  * CVE-2025-38524: rxrpc: Fix recv-recv race of completed call (bsc#1248194).
  * CVE-2025-38520: drm/amdkfd: Do not call mmput from MMU notifier callback
    (bsc#1248217).
  * CVE-2025-38514: rxrpc: Fix oops due to non-existence of prealloc backlog
    struct (bsc#1248202).
  * CVE-2025-38506: KVM: Allow CPU to reschedule while setting per-page memory
    attributes (bsc#1248186).
  * CVE-2025-38500: xfrm: interface: fix use-after-free after changing
    collect_md xfrm interface (bsc#1248088).
  * CVE-2025-38499: clone_private_mnt(): make sure that caller has CAP_SYS_ADMIN
    in the right userns (bsc#1247976).
  * CVE-2025-38491: mptcp: make fallback action and fallback decision atomic
    (bsc#1247280).
  * CVE-2025-38488: smb: client: fix use-after-free in crypt_message when using
    async crypto (bsc#1247239).
  * CVE-2025-38472: netfilter: nf_conntrack: fix crash due to removal of
    uninitialised entry (bsc#1247313).
  * CVE-2025-38466: perf: Revert to requiring CAP_SYS_ADMIN for uprobes
    (bsc#1247442).
  * CVE-2025-38464: tipc: Fix use-after-free in tipc_conn_close() (bsc#1247112).
  * CVE-2025-38459: atm: clip: Fix infinite recursive call of clip_push()
    (bsc#1247119).
  * CVE-2025-38458: atm: clip: Fix NULL pointer dereference in vcc_sendmsg()
    (bsc#1247116).
  * CVE-2025-38456: ipmi:msghandler: Fix potential memory corruption in
    ipmi_create_user() (bsc#1247099).
  * CVE-2025-38445: md/raid1: Fix stack memory use after return in raid1_reshape
    (bsc#1247229).
  * CVE-2025-38444: raid10: cleanup memleak at raid10_make_request
    (bsc#1247162).
  * CVE-2025-38441: netfilter: flowtable: account for Ethernet header in
    nf_flow_pppoe_proto() (bsc#1247167).
  * CVE-2025-38439: bnxt_en: Set DMA unmap len correctly for XDP_REDIRECT
    (bsc#1247155).
  * CVE-2025-38419: remoteproc: core: Cleanup acquired resources when
    rproc_handle_resources() fails in rproc_attach() (bsc#1247136).
  * CVE-2025-38418: remoteproc: core: Release rproc->clean_table after
    rproc_attach() fails (bsc#1247137).
  * CVE-2025-38408: genirq/irq_sim: Initialize work context pointers properly
    (bsc#1247126).
  * CVE-2025-38402: idpf: return 0 size for RSS key if not supported
    (bsc#1247262).
  * CVE-2025-38360: drm/amd/display: Add more checks for DSC / HUBP ONO
    guarantees (bsc#1247078).
  * CVE-2025-38263: bcache: fix NULL pointer in cache_set_flush() (bsc#1246248).
  * CVE-2025-38251: atm: clip: prevent NULL deref in clip_push() (bsc#1246181).
  * CVE-2025-38245: atm: Release atm_dev_mutex after removing procfs in
    atm_dev_deregister() (bsc#1246193).
  * CVE-2025-38208: smb: client: add NULL check in automount_fullpath
    (bsc#1245815).
  * CVE-2025-38205: drm/amd/display: Avoid divide by zero by initializing dummy
    pitch to 1 (bsc#1246005).
  * CVE-2025-38201: netfilter: nft_set_pipapo: clamp maximum map bucket size to
    INT_MAX (bsc#1245977).
  * CVE-2025-38190: atm: Revert atm_account_tx() if copy_from_iter_full() fails
    (bsc#1245973).
  * CVE-2025-38185: atm: atmtcp: Free invalid length skb in atmtcp_c_send()
    (bsc#1246012).
  * CVE-2025-38184: tipc: fix null-ptr-deref when acquiring remote ip of
    ethernet bearer (bsc#1245956).
  * CVE-2025-38160: clk: bcm: rpi: Add NULL check in raspberrypi_clk_register()
    (bsc#1245780).
  * CVE-2025-38146: net: openvswitch: Fix the dead loop of MPLS parse
    (bsc#1245767).
  * CVE-2025-38125: net: stmmac: make sure that ptp_rate is not 0 before
    configuring EST (bsc#1245710).
  * CVE-2025-38103: HID: usbhid: Eliminate recurrent out-of-bounds bug in
    usbhid_parse() (bsc#1245663).
  * CVE-2025-38075: scsi: target: iscsi: Fix timeout on deleted connection
    (bsc#1244734).
  * CVE-2025-38006: net: mctp: Do not access ifa_index when missing
    (bsc#1244930).
  * CVE-2025-37885: KVM: x86: Reset IRTE to host control if _new_ route isn't
    postable (bsc#1242960).
  * CVE-2025-22022: usb: xhci: Apply the link chain quirk on NEC isoc endpoints
    (bsc#1241292).
  * CVE-2024-53125: bpf: sync_linked_regs() must preserve subreg_def
    (bsc#1234156).
  * CVE-2024-46733: btrfs: fix qgroup reserve leaks in cow_file_range
    (bsc#1230708).
